Precision agriculture systems encompass a range of advanced technologies and data-driven approaches designed to optimize various aspects of farming practices. These systems utilize sensors, GPS technology, data analytics, and automation to collect and analyze information about soil conditions, weather patterns, crop health, and other relevant factors. By integrating this data, farmers can make informed decisions regarding crop management, resource allocation, and the timing of agricultural operations. Precision agriculture systems enable precise application of fertilizers, pesticides, and water, minimizing waste and environmental impact. Additionally, they may involve the use of drones or satellite imagery for field monitoring and assessment. The goal of precision agriculture systems is to enhance overall farm productivity, reduce input costs, and promote sustainability by tailoring farming practices to specific conditions and optimizing resource utilization.
